Catholic Mass Readings For Wednesday, September 18, 2013
FIRST READING: 1 Timothy 3: 14 - 16
14
These things I write to thee, hoping that I shall come to thee
shortly.
15
But if I tarry long, that thou mayest know how thou oughtest to
behave thyself in the house of God, which is the church of the living
God, the pillar and ground of the truth.
16
And evidently great is the mystery of godliness, which was manifested
in the flesh, was justified in the spirit, appeared unto angels, hath
been preached unto the Gentiles, is believed in the world, is taken
up in glory.

31
And the Lord said: Whereunto then shall I liken the men of this
generation? and to what are they like?
32
They are like to children sitting in the marketplace, and speaking
one to another, and saying: We have piped to you, and you have not
danced: we have mourned, and you have not wept.
33
For John the Baptist came neither eating bread nor drinking wine; and
you say: He hath a devil.
34
The Son of man is come eating and drinking: and you say: Behold a man
that is a glutton and a drinker of wine, a friend of publicans and
sinners.
35
And wisdom is justified by all her children.
